A193647 Number of arrays of -7..7 integers x(1..n) with every x(i) in a subsequence of length 1 or 2 with sum zero 2

%I #7 Feb 19 2015 14:07:41

%S 1,15,43,267,1065,5377,23801,113191,517371,2416835,11155313,51830017,

%T 239940625,1112996767,5157111051,23910123931,110818577241,

%U 513715752705,2381164556233,11037736722167,51163163871835,237160332965907

%N Number of arrays of -7..7 integers x(1..n) with every x(i) in a subsequence of length 1 or 2 with sum zero

%C Column 7 of A193648

%H R. H. Hardin, <a href="/A193647/b193647.txt">Table of n, a(n) for n = 1..200</a>

%F Empirical: a(n) = 2*a(n-1) +12*a(n-2) +a(n-3).

%F Empirical: G.f.: -x*(1+13*x+x^2) / ( -1+2*x+12*x^2+x^3 ). - _R. J. Mathar_, Feb 19 2015
